Kent State University at Ashtabula vs Wagner College
Ashtabula, OH — Staten Island, NY
| Metric | Kent State University at Ashtabula Ashtabula, OH | Wagner College Staten Island, NY |
|---|---|---|
| Location | Ashtabula, OH | Staten Island, NY |
| Type | Public | Private Nonprofit |
| Total Enrollment | 1,290 | 1,651 |
| Acceptance Rate | — | 88.0% |
| SAT Average | — | 1,243 |
| In-State Tuition | $7,492 | $53,200 |
| Out-of-State Tuition | $17,342 | $53,200 |
| Avg Net Price | $12,205 | $28,241 |
| Median Debt at Graduation | $24,500 | $25,000 |
| 4-Year Graduation Rate | 25.3% | 66.7% |
| Retention Rate | 48.6% | 83.4% |
| Median Earnings (6 yr) | $40,179 | $63,439 |
| Median Earnings (10 yr) | $45,388 | $74,360 |

Frequently Asked Questions
How do Kent State University at Ashtabula and Wagner College compare?▼
Kent State University at Ashtabula (Ashtabula, OH) has no published acceptance rate, in-state tuition of $7,492, and median 10-year earnings of $45,388. Wagner College (Staten Island, NY) has an acceptance rate of 88.0%, in-state tuition of $53,200, and median 10-year earnings of $74,360.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, Kent State University at Ashtabula or Wagner College?▼
Wagner College gra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$74,360 vs $45,388.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, Kent State University at Ashtabula or Wagner College?▼
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), Kent State University at Ashtabula is the more affordable option at $12,205 per year versus $28,241.
Which school has a better 4-year graduation rate?▼
Wagner College has the higher 4-year graduation rate: 66.7% vs 25.3%.
